Description
This One Pot Creamy Tomato Beef Pasta is a comforting and flavorful dish that comes together easily in just one pot. Tender pasta is cooked in a creamy tomato sauce with seasoned ground beef, topped with gooey cheese, and finished with fresh herbs for a satisfying meal.
Ingredients

For the Pasta:
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 medium on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ional)
- 1 can (24 ounces) marinara sauce
- 3 cups beef broth
- 12 ounces short pasta (penne, rotini, or similar)
For the Creamy Sauce:
- 1/2 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- Fresh basil or parsley for garnish
Instructions
- In a large pot or deep sk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Add ground beef and cook until browned, breaking it apart as it cooks, about 5–6 minutes. Drain excess grease if needed. Add onion and cook for 3 minutes until softened. Stir in gar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es if using. C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.
- Stir in marinara sauce and beef broth, then add pasta. Bring to a boil, re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er for 12–14 minutes, stirring occasionally, until pasta is al dente.
- Reduce heat to low and stir in heavy cream, mozzarella, and Parmesan until melted and creamy. Taste and adjust seasoning as needed. Garnish with fresh basil or parsley before serving.
Notes
- For extra flavor, use fire-roasted marinara sauce and top with additional Parmesan before serving.
- This dish reheats well for meal prep.
